Chinese Academy of Sciences Institute of Electronics officially started construction

In the morning of September 3, the Suzhou Research Institute of the Institute of Electronics of the Chinese Academy of Sciences officially started construction. The project is located in the southeastern part of Suzhou Nancheng District and covers an area of ​​130 mu, of which a phase 1 construction area is approximately 47,000 square meters. It is planned to be completed and put into use in early 2018. Wang Xiang, member of the Standing Committee of the Suzhou Municipal Party Committee and Secretary of the Industry Committee of the Park, Xie Zhiping, deputy secretary of the Park Working Committee and director of the Administrative Committee, and Xia Fang, deputy director of the Administrative Committee of the Park, attended the opening ceremony.

The Institute of Electronics of the Chinese Academy of Sciences is the first integrated electronics and information science research institute established in China in 1956. It is the primary mission to solve the major critical technologies and overall system solutions for electronic systems and electronic devices that are urgently needed by the country. The development of independent innovation that supports national defense construction and economic society will play a leading and leading role in related domestic fields. At present, the Institute of Electronics of the Chinese Academy of Sciences has formed six major fields: microwave imaging technology, serialized space traveling wave tubes, geospatial information technology, and aviation remote sensing systems, as well as microwave imaging radar technology and microwave vacuum technology. Suzhou Nancheng City is the world's largest integrated community for nanotechnology application industry. It possesses functions such as "innovation and R&D, pilot project piloting, small-scale production, achievement transformation, patent operation, industrial service, headquarters office, conference display, and comprehensive support". January 18, 2013 was formally put into use. As of August 2016, the area invested more than 300,000 square meters, and a total of more than 260 nanotechnology-related companies were contracted and settled, including the Suzhou Research Institute of the Chinese Academy of Sciences and the Institute of Electronics of the Chinese Academy of Sciences in Suzhou. According to Wu Yijun, academician of the Chinese Academy of Sciences and the director of the Institute of Electronics, Chinese Academy of Sciences, Suzhou Institute of Electronics, Chinese Academy of Sciences, covers electronic information systems such as integrated network information systems, sensors, programmable chip technology, laser radar, and urban intelligent management based on geospatial big data. In the direction of the field, we will carry out core key technology research, common technology research and development, technology system integration, engineering demonstration application and industrialization, and achieve effective penetration of the industrial chain, innovation chain, and capital chain. Since it was settled in the Suzhou Industrial Park in June 2014, the Suzhou Research Institute of the Institute of Electronics of the Chinese Academy of Sciences has adopted a talent introduction and intern training, screening, and joining methods. It has established a research and development team with more than 400 people and has applied it in space information, MEMS, etc. It has carried out a lot of fruitful work and has undertaken a number of major tasks such as the national 863 project, major national defense tasks, and Chinese Academy of Sciences.

There are many different types of Forged flanges, such as weld neck flange, Plate Flange , Slip On Flange, Blind Flange , Socket Weld Flange, Threaded Flange, spectacle flange (sometimes it is called figure-8 blind flange), lap joint flange and so on. 

Main materials are carbon steel, alloy steel and stainless steel. For carbon steel, ASTM A105 & A105N are required by most project.304/304L,316/316L,321,etc belong to stainless Steel Flange . The sealing face of forged flanges in common use is raised face(RF), flat face(FF) and ring type joint(RTJ).
